The Halifax County Sheriff’s Office requested State Bureau of Investigation arson experts to probe a suspicious fire off West Tenth Street Sunday morning.
The fire destroyed the house located behind Colonial Drive, Lieutenant Bobby Martin said this morning.
The fire call was received at approximately 4:45 a.m. and Davie volunteer firefighters responded.
Martin said after firefighters got the blaze under control they felt it was suspicious and contacted the sheriff’s office.
Davie Chief David Padgett said firefighters deemed the blaze suspicious because no one was home and firefighters could not pinpoint an origin.
It took firefighters between 20 to 30 minutes to control the fire.
